Instructions
In a bowl, fold together the duck mousse, cream cheese, and chopped cranberries.
Drizzle in the elderflower liquor and stir until combined.
Chill the mixture for 30 minutes in the refrigerator. In the meantime, place crushed pecans on a plate.
Once mixture is chilled, remove from fridge and using greased hands (a little olive oil does the trick) quickly form into a ball. Place on plate and coat with crushed pecans on all side.
Place back in the refrigerator until ready to serve alongside fresh fruit, nuts, and crackers.
Notes
*Elderflower liquor lends to providing a slight floral and sweet note to this recipe. If you don't have any on hand, a teaspoon of Grand Marnier (orange liquor) works as well.
